* CHUM Television has appointed Ellen Baine VP programming. In her new capacity, Baine will be responsible for supervising programming strategies, acquisitions and planning for CHUM’s broadcast and specialty channels.

She started with CHUM at Citytv in 1991 as program manager and, in time, took on director of programming roles for City, Star! and CHUM diginets FashionTelevisionChannel and SexTV.

Also, Marcia Martin has been named CHUM’s VP production. In the newly created position, Martin will watch over the production of CHUM’s local TV stations. She was previously VP production for City, and will continue as VP and GM of FashionTelevisionChannel, Star! and SexTV.

Maria Hale has been named the new VP of City. Hale is stepping up from her former position as managing director, interactive. Prior to her appointment at CHUM, Hale held executive positions at Excite, TMP Worldwide and Interactive Media Group.

Laura Aylon-Regu is stepping up to publicist at Bravo! from her former post of communications coordinator and Alison Salinas moves up to publicist at Space from communications coordinator at the station.

* Joan Vogelesang has been appointed president of Montreal-based Toon Boom Technologies, replacing outgoing president Jacques Bilodeau. Toon Boom provides USAnimation and Toon Boom Studio 2D animation software as well as services to producers and creators.

Vogelesang previously served as Toon Boom’s COO and will retain her responsibilities overseeing sales, marketing and operations.

* Vivavision has appointed Sari Buksner GM of Vivamondo, the company’s international division responsible for financing programs targeting the international marketplace.

Buksner is a 15-year TV industry veteran who previously held the post of senior VP international sales and development with The Multimedia Group of Canada since 1989.

* William Morris, a former marketing executive with Walt Disney Company in Europe, has been named director of marketing at Paris-based Reed MIDEM. He will oversee marketing of Reed MIDEM’s international exhibitions, which include MIDEM, MIPTV, MIPCOM, MIPIM, MAPIC, MILIA and WEM.
